Tactic from GenCon Seminar

The BOD and I attended an advanced dnd tactics seminar on Saturday afternoon. While it was not what we expected as it focused on building/improving a gaming group, there was a good idea that we picked up on to help prep for the DM and lessen downtime. Before each session, the PCs should plan out which general direction they would like to head for the next gaming session. Helps get the flow of the gaming session going and helps the DM by not needing to prep the entire floor of a dungeon for one session. If we're able to get a map up of our current progress thru the dungeon, do ya'll think this sounds like a good idea? We did pick up some nice software at GenCon that has you input a 2-D dungeon layout and automatically can transform it to a 3-D rendering with dungeon-y walls that can be used for this, too.
